Born in Plattsmouth, NE, printmaker Carol Meis Ellington studied commercial art at Omaha Art School and Studios and earned a BFA in Printmaking from Bellevue University. She is particularly accomplished in creating woodcuts and etchings, and she frequently uses river imagery as a symbol of salvation. A veteran of numerous solo and group shows throughout the United States, the artist is the recipient of numerous awards and honors, and her work is included in both public and private collections.
